發(fā)起的測試健康管理系統(tǒng)和方法
【專利說明】發(fā)起的測試健康管理系統(tǒng)和方法
[0001]關(guān)于聯(lián)邦資助的研宄或開發(fā)的聲明
本發(fā)明在美國空軍研宄實驗室(AFRL)獎勵的FA8650-08-D-7803下得到政府支持的情況下做出。政府在本發(fā)明中具有某些權(quán)利。
技術(shù)領(lǐng)域
[0002]本發(fā)明總體涉及健康管理,并且更具體地,涉及使用各種健康相關(guān)數(shù)據(jù)確定控制效應(yīng)器(effector)的喪失的和/或剩余的功能能力的系統(tǒng)和方法。
【背景技術(shù)】
[0003]諸如各種類型的交通工具(vehicle)的各種系統(tǒng)和包括交通工具的系統(tǒng)與子系統(tǒng)可能經(jīng)受潛在嚴峻的環(huán)境條件、沖擊、震動和正常部件磨損。這些條件以及其它可能對交通工具的操作性具有有害的影響。這些有害影響如果在操作期間經(jīng)歷的話可能留下很少的時間用于糾正行動。因此,在交通工具的環(huán)境中最顯著的是,健康監(jiān)視/管理系統(tǒng)正與日俱增地被使用。交通工具健康監(jiān)視/管理系統(tǒng)監(jiān)視交通工具的各種健康相關(guān)特性。在一些實例中,這樣的操作健康特性可以被進一步分解為交通工具的主要操作系統(tǒng)和子系統(tǒng)的健康特性。
[0004]一些目前已知的交通工具健康管理系統(tǒng)包括從傳感器收集數(shù)據(jù)和其它機載信號以產(chǎn)生結(jié)果的監(jiān)視器。這些結(jié)果然后被提供給推理器(reasoner),推理器嘗試基于該信息診斷交通工具的健康。有時,該信息緩慢地到達或者根本未到達推理器。例如,在自主交通工具的發(fā)射(lift-off)之前,命令尚未被提供給控制效應(yīng)器,并且健康管理具有的信息不足以用其來診斷效應(yīng)器健康。為了克服該缺陷,往往執(zhí)行飛行前檢查,飛行前檢查鍛煉控制效應(yīng)器以驗證它們的操作。作為第二個示例,如果可疑的效應(yīng)器故障在自主交通工具飛行期間發(fā)生,則將期望的是在開始之后盡可能快地評估效應(yīng)器的健康。因為有時其中命令為最少的飛行期間,所以評估健康可能必須有意地鍛煉可疑的效應(yīng)器而同時注意維持控制。在健康信息的量和類型或者信息的生成速率方面的缺陷可能限制健康管理系統(tǒng)提供對交通工具能力的迅速評估的能力,從而潛在地使任務(wù)、交通工具或二者處于危險當中。
[0005]因此,存在對這樣的系統(tǒng)和方法的需要,所述系統(tǒng)和方法將加速至健康管理系統(tǒng)的信息流,以能夠提供對系統(tǒng)健康的更迅速的診斷。本發(fā)明至少解決了該需要。
【發(fā)明內(nèi)容】
[0006]提供本概述來以簡化形式描述在【具體實施方式】中進一步描述的選擇概念。本概述并不意圖標識所要求保護的主題的關(guān)鍵或必要特征,也不意圖用作在確定所要求保護的主題的范圍中的幫助。
[0007]在一個實施例中,一種用于驗證控制效應(yīng)器的響應(yīng)能力的方法包括:在測試模塊中至少處理命令數(shù)據(jù)和與控制效應(yīng)器相關(guān)聯(lián)的傳感器數(shù)據(jù),以生成代表控制效應(yīng)器健康的控制效應(yīng)器健康數(shù)據(jù)。在推理器中處理控制效應(yīng)器健康數(shù)據(jù)以:選擇性控訴(indict)和清除一個或多個故障,基于所控訴的一個或多個故障確定失效是不確定的,確定一個或多個測試激勵信號以供應(yīng)給所述控制效應(yīng)器來驗證不確定失效是存在還是不存在,以及向能與所述控制效應(yīng)器操作地通信的控制器供應(yīng)所述一個或多個測試激勵信號。
[0008]在另一實施例中,一種用于確定控制效應(yīng)器的響應(yīng)能力的系統(tǒng),包括測試模塊和推理器。測試模塊被適配成至少接收命令數(shù)據(jù)和與控制效應(yīng)器相關(guān)聯(lián)的傳感器數(shù)據(jù)。所述測試模塊被配置為在接收這些數(shù)據(jù)時生成代表控制效應(yīng)器健康的控制效應(yīng)器健康數(shù)據(jù)。推理器被耦合來接收所述控制效應(yīng)器健康數(shù)據(jù)并且被配置為響應(yīng)于其而(i )選擇性控訴和清除一個或多個故障,(ii )確定可被所控訴的一個或多個故障引起的可疑失效,(iii )確定一個或多個測試激勵信號以供應(yīng)給所述控制效應(yīng)器來驗證所述可疑失效是否是實際失效,以及(iv)向能與所述控制效應(yīng)器操作地通信的控制器供應(yīng)所述一個或多個測試激勵信號。
[0009]此外,根據(jù)后續(xù)的【具體實施方式】、結(jié)合附圖和該背景,發(fā)起的測試健康管理系統(tǒng)和方法的其它期望特征和特性將變得清楚。
【附圖說明】
[0010]后文將結(jié)合以下附圖來描述本發(fā)明,其中,相同的附圖標記表示相同的元素,并且其中:
圖1描繪了示例交通工具引導和控制系統(tǒng)的實施例的功能框圖;
圖2描繪了可以在圖1的系統(tǒng)中使用的子系統(tǒng)健康管理系統(tǒng)的示例性實施例的功能框圖;
圖3描繪了推理器的示例知識庫,其圖示了子系統(tǒng)健康管理系統(tǒng)的功能的一部分;
圖4用圖形描繪了子系統(tǒng)健康管理系統(tǒng)的總體功能的簡化表示;
圖5-8以ISO 10303-11 EXPRESS-G格式描繪了可以在子系統(tǒng)健康管理系統(tǒng)中使用的推理器的知識庫的信息模型;
圖9-11以流程圖形式描繪了可以在圖2的推理器中實現(xiàn)來驗證可疑故障的不同過程;
以及
圖12用圖形描繪了用于圖1的系統(tǒng)的數(shù)據(jù),其中連續(xù)域控制效應(yīng)器遭受降級域限制失效。
【具體實施方式】
[0011]以下【具體實施方式】本質(zhì)上僅僅是示例性的并且不意圖限制本發(fā)明或本發(fā)明的應(yīng)用和使用。如本文所使用的,詞語“示例性的”意指“充當示例、實例或說明”。因此,本文中描述為“示例性的”任何實施例不一定解釋為對于其它實施例是優(yōu)選或有利的。本文描述的所有實施例是示例性實施例,其提供來使本領(lǐng)域技術(shù)人員能夠做出或使用本發(fā)明并且不限制權(quán)利要求所限定的本發(fā)明的范圍。此外,不意圖由前面的技術(shù)領(lǐng)域、【背景技術(shù)】、
【發(fā)明內(nèi)容】
或以下【具體實施方式】中給出的任何明示或暗示的理論來限界。
[0012]交通工具引導和控制系統(tǒng)100的實施例的功能框圖在圖1中描繪,并且包括交通工具控制系統(tǒng)102和一個或多個子系統(tǒng)健康管理系統(tǒng)104 (例如,104-1、104-2、104-3……104-N)。交通工具控制系統(tǒng)102實現(xiàn)至少一個或多個自適應(yīng)控制法則,其生成并向在例如交通工具110中或上的各種部件109供應(yīng)各種命令106。這些部件可以不同,但是至少包括多個控制效應(yīng)器(例如,109-1、109-2、109-3……109-N),所述控制效應(yīng)器被配置為控制例如一個或多個設(shè)備的位置。
[0013]交通工具控制系統(tǒng)102還從例如交通工具110中或上的各種傳感器接收反饋108,并從一個或多個子系統(tǒng)健康管理系統(tǒng)104接收數(shù)據(jù)112。交通工具控制系統(tǒng)102中的一個或多個控制法則是自適應(yīng)控制法則,因為這些控制法則自適應(yīng)地對從一個或多個子系統(tǒng)健康管理系統(tǒng)104供應(yīng)的數(shù)據(jù)做出響應(yīng)。交通工具控制系統(tǒng)102中實現(xiàn)的自適應(yīng)控制法則的典型響應(yīng)是將去往效應(yīng)器的進一步命令限制為其減小的可用范圍,并且當必要時更多地利用其它效應(yīng)器以維持控制。進一步的響應(yīng)可以包括改變交通工具的操作的包絡(luò)(envelope)和改變?nèi)蝿?wù)計劃??梢允褂帽绢I(lǐng)域公知的許多已知自適應(yīng)控制法則方案中的任何一種來實現(xiàn)自適應(yīng)控制法則。
[0014]子系統(tǒng)健康管理系統(tǒng)104中的一個或多個被耦合來接收各種輸入,諸如供應(yīng)到交通工具控制系統(tǒng)102和/或?qū)S糜诮】当O(jiān)視的傳感器的命令106和反饋108的至少一部分。這一個或多個子系統(tǒng)健康管理系統(tǒng)104部分基于這些輸入被附加地配置為檢測、隔離和量化可能在相關(guān)聯(lián)的子系統(tǒng)內(nèi)發(fā)生的各種故障、失效和降級,并且將代表其的數(shù)據(jù)供應(yīng)到交通工具控制系統(tǒng)102中的自適應(yīng)控制法則。為了向交通工具控制系統(tǒng)102提供最準確的信息,子系統(tǒng)健康管理系統(tǒng)104被配置為不僅報告全部功能失效,而且還報告能力的參數(shù)化降級。因此,這些子系統(tǒng)健康管理系統(tǒng)104被配置為處理各種診斷復雜性,包括但不限于:模糊性、等待時間、漏報和假警報?,F(xiàn)在參照圖2,描繪了子系統(tǒng)健康管理系統(tǒng)104的示例性實施例的功能框圖,并且現(xiàn)在將對其進行描述。
[0015]示例性子系統(tǒng)健康管理系統(tǒng)104包括測試模塊202和子系統(tǒng)推理器204。測試模塊202被耦合來至少接收命令數(shù)據(jù)和與控制效應(yīng)器109中的一個或多個相關(guān)聯(lián)的傳感器數(shù)據(jù),并且被配置為在接收到這些數(shù)據(jù)時生成代表控制效應(yīng)器健康的控制效應(yīng)器健康數(shù)據(jù)。在具體實施例中,測試模塊202被配置為連續(xù)或間歇地對相關(guān)聯(lián)的子系統(tǒng)(例如,控制效應(yīng)器)實現(xiàn)各種測試和/或測量,并且生成代表子系統(tǒng)健康的健康數(shù)據(jù)(例如,健康良好/健康差)。然后將健康數(shù)據(jù)供應(yīng)到子系統(tǒng)推理器204。測試模塊202生成和供應(yīng)的健康數(shù)據(jù)可以改變,并且可以包括例如用以指示子系統(tǒng)的部件或部分是健康的/不健康的通過(PASS)/失敗(FAIL)數(shù)據(jù)。健康數(shù)據(jù)可以附加地包括這樣的數(shù)據(jù),該數(shù)據(jù)指示特定的條件對于執(zhí)行測試是不恰當?shù)?,諸如返回結(jié)果NOT_AVAILABLE (不可用)或保持靜默。一些測試可以具有兩個或更多失效準則。對于這樣的測試,健康數(shù)據(jù)可以包括有限制的失敗數(shù)據(jù),諸如,例如通過/失敗-HI/失敗-LO等。如可以意識到的,不同的失效準則可能導致不同的失效結(jié)論。
[0016]將意識到,測試模塊202可以不同地配置為實現(xiàn)其功能。然而,在所描繪的實施例中,測試模塊202使用一個或多個內(nèi)建測試模塊206(例如,206-1、206-2、206-3……206-N)和一個或多個監(jiān)視器模塊208 (208-1,208-2,208-3……208-N)來實現(xiàn)其功能。如所公知的,內(nèi)建測試(BIT)模塊206被配置為在子系統(tǒng)和/或部件上實現(xiàn)一個或多個測試過程以確定子系統(tǒng)和/或部件是否在正確地起作用。
[0017]監(jiān)視器模塊208 (其在本文也可以稱為參數(shù)化限制監(jiān)視器模塊)被配置為接收代表一個或多個子系統(tǒng)參數(shù)的各種數(shù)據(jù),并且確定未被BIT模塊206測試(或可能未被BIT模塊206充分測試)的子系統(tǒng)和/或部件是否正確地起作用。此外,監(jiān)視器模塊208中的一個